Methodology - Fast Track MBA


  • Courage, vision, consistency: This part-time MBA program focuses on individuals who want to actively shape their future and consistently optimize and expand their areas of responsibility

  • Inspiring: For decades, our top instructors have been training experienced executives and highly ambitious managers and junior staff. With top international partners, we continuously update our program ideas for demanding participants who want to understand and shape the future.


  • StGallen Concept: Integrated approach according to the StGallen concept with a focus on general management, leadership skills, innovation, digital and change competence.


  • Entrepreneurial - transfer-oriented: The Fast Track MBA is focused on future leaders, doers, founders and managers with an entrepreneurial gene, which is why the training is designed in the logic of modern fast track and scale-up mindsets: It starts with a business idea (innovation), then develops the key directions, defines the processes, structures, staffing and ends with concrete financial and concrete master plans.

 

  • Unique management transfer concept: Integrated project work focuses on company-relevant, practical initiatives that truly advance companies sustainably. This also means no "consumerism" in seminars—you are placed directly in the "cockpit" – supported by your trainers.

  • Plannable yet flexible: The program is flexible, consistently innovative, and fully tailored to your work, as it integrates practical experience. You create your own study plan and select the dates that best suit your needs for the seminars you wish to attend over the next 15-24 months. In total, there are approximately 23 face-to-face days, plus seven days of hybrid (i.e., online or on-site).

At a glance

Program type

Master of Business Administration

(MBA)

Length of time

7x3-4 Take on-campus

4 Tage i.d.R. hybrid

Introduction

Anytime, flexible entry, admission requirements

Format

Presence and hybrid

Costs

CHF 24.900

plus CH VAT

ECTS

60

(90)

Language

i.d.R. Deutsch

Target group

(future) leaders and managers

Network

Exclusive: St.Gallen imt alumni

Next dates

Flexible entry, freely selectable order of modules, part-time and integrated.

State-recognized qualification


Master of Business Administration from Steinbeis University (Bologna System conformity)
